Electrical connections

• Connection to the power supply must be carried out in
compliance with the regulations and provisions in force in
the country of use.
• Make sure the machine power supply voltage specified on
the rating plate matches the mains voltage.
• Make sure the system power supply is arranged and able to
take the actual current load and that it is executed in a
workmanlike manner according to the regulations in force in
the country of use.
• The earth wire from the terminal board side must be longer
(max 20 mm) than the phase wires.
• Connect the power cable earth wire to an efficient earth.
The equipment must also be included in an equipotential
system, whose connection is made by means of screw EQ
(see par. Installation diagram) indicated by the symbol
The equipotential wire must have a section of at least 10
mm
2
.
Power supply 380-415V 3N~
Open the power supply terminal board and insert the jumpers
provided as follows: one jumper between terminals 2 and 4
and another between terminals 4 and 6. Using a suitable
power supply cable (see D TECHNICAL DATA table), connect
the three phases to terminals 1, 3 and 5, the neutral to terminal
6 and the earth wire to the terminal

Power supply 400 - 440V 3
Open the power supply terminal board and insert the jumpers
provided as follows: one jumper between terminals 2 and 4
and another between terminals 4 and 6. Using a suitable
power supply cable (see D TECHNICAL DATA table), connect
the three phases to terminals 1, 3 and 5, the neutral to terminal
6 and the earth wire to the terminal

Power supply 220 - 230V 3
Open the power supply terminal board and insert the jumpers
provided as follows: one jumper between terminals 1 and 2,
one between terminals 3 and 4 and another between terminals
5 and 6. Using a suitable power supply cable (see D
TECHNICAL DATA table) connect the three phases to
terminals 1, 3 and 5 and the earth wire to the terminal

Power supply 220 - 230V 1N
Open the power supply terminal board and insert the jumpers
provided as follows: two jumpers between terminals 1, 3, 5 and
another two between terminals 2, 4 and 6. Using a suitable
power supply cable (see D TECHNICAL DATA table), connect
the phase and neutral to terminals 5 and 6 respectively and the
earth wire to the terminal
